convert etl to pcap powershell

1

On Windows 10 Microsoft provides a utility Pktmon that convert ETL file to Wireshark's latest format PCAPNG. export that data into a standard .CAP file which could then be used by lots of other networking applications like Wireshark. Accepts a literal path to a location containing ETL files or the literal path to a single ETL file. Use a proper tool to interact with the etl instead. sent or to which the packet was delivered, since the packet capture provider To convert your ETL file the command is: Using that to convert the ETL file I captured earlier: Now I can open the PCAPNG file in my favorite networking tool. This will execute Convert-Etl2Pcapng with default settings against the ETL file.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Microsoft have a couple of examples on how to read .etl files using C++ and the native APIs. sign in When using NETSH to capture a network trace, it generates a specializedfile with anETLfile extension. Lucky for us theres an easy conversion utility etl2pcapng. The Out parameter can be used to store the results in a new location; otherwise, the same path as the ETL file is used. Asking for help, clarification, or responding to other answers. packet Except, we ran into a problem. Microsoft Message Analyzer has been discontinued. Work fast with our official CLI. It also captures some related diagnostic information and compresses that information into a CAB file. Not the answer you're looking for? To separate all the packets in the capture from dropped packets, generate two pcapng files; one that contains all the packets (", Pcapng format doesn't distinguish between different networking components where a packet was captured. Therefore, log contents should be carefully pre-filtered for such conversion. Microsoft Message Analyzer was our tool to capture, display and analyze protocol messaging traffic. Unregisters the shell context menu item for Convert-Etl2Pcapng. Start a Network Trace Session First, I recommend to run the following in your Windows box to get more familiarized with the . To learn more, see our tips on writing great answers. Copy and Paste the following command to install this package using PowerShellGet More Info, You can deploy this package directly to Azure Automation. analyze the data and will report back with any conclusions or next steps. This PowerShell wrapper extends the functionality of, and provides automated management and updates for, etl2pcapng.exe. The Update-Module cmdlet can be used to install newer versions of the module if it is already installed. Open .ETL Files with NetworkMiner and CapLoader Windows event tracing .etl files can now be read by NetworkMiner and CapLoader without having to first convert them to .pcap or .pcapng. Contributor License Agreement (CLA) declaring that you have the right to, and actually do, grant us provided by the bot. The nature of simulating nature: A Q&A with IBM Quantum researcher Dr. Jamie We've added a "Necessary cookies only" option to the cookie consent popup. Once reproduced,stop the trace to generate the ETL file. NETSH is a great tool built into the Windows OS and can be used to configure many parts of the networking stack within your Windows OS. These logs can be analyzed using Wireshark (or any pcapng analyzer); however, some of the critical information could be missing in the pcapng files. If you dont feel like building the tool from source, check out the. It. Microsoft Message Analyzer was our tool to capture, display and analyze protocol messaging traffic. Both NetworkMiner and CapLoader leverage Windows specific API calls to read packets from ETL files. Find out more about the Microsoft MVP Award Program. This allows you to generate the ETL fileon the server, copy to your local machine, or approved jump box/tools machine/etcand convert the ETL file there. Unfortunately, there is no out-of-the-box .NET way of doing this. If a law is new but its interpretation is vague, can the courts directly ask the drafters the intent and official interpretation of their law? With today's release of Pktmon, you can now perform real-time packet monitoring from the command line. sql / ssis / transformation / etl / informatica. We can grab the local IPv4 address and save it as a variable.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. You can find the original article here. Convert-Etl2Pcapng Perhaps this is not the answer you're looking for, but I recommend nonetheless. Parts of the module will technically run on PowerShell 7 in Linux, macOS, and FreeBSD, but the required etl2pcapng.exe is currently a Windows-only binary. vegan) just to try it, does this inconvenience the caterers and staff? https://github.com/microsoft/etl2pcapng/releases. For example: More info about Internet Explorer and Microsoft Edge, Pcapng format doesn't distinguish between a flowing packet and a dropped packet. 1.8.0 - Adding RSS Hash value to packet comments for VMSwitch packets. How do you get into that? You signed in with another tab or window. The Microsoft support organizations do not, and cannot, support this module since it is an OSS project and not an in-box product component or feature. #>. recent support issue I ran into. To convert your ETL file the command is: Etl2pcapng.exe file.etl newfile.pcapng Using that to convert the ETL file I captured earlier: Otherwise, register and sign in. This site uses cookies for analytics, personalized content and ads. Learn More, MSFTNet But the ETL filehas all the network trace data. Update-Etl2Pcapng. Are you sure you want to create this branch?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. Making statements based on opinion; back them up with references or personal experience. Why are non-Western countries siding with China in the UN? Minimum PowerShell version 5.1 Installation Options Install Module Azure Automation Manual Download Copy and Paste the following command to install this package using PowerShellGet More Info Install-Module -Name Convert-Etl2Pcapng Author (s) Well, as I mentioned above, Microsoft has the Microsoft Message Analyzer which can open these files and even convert them to a format other networking tools can read. (LogOut/ Short story taking place on a toroidal planet or moon involving flying, Acidity of alcohols and basicity of amines. A PowerShell wrapper for etl2pcapng, which converts packet captures. To illustrate how to convert an ETL file to a PCAPNG file, we will use the PktMon.etl log created from our previous FTP real-time monitoring example. Asking for help, clarification, or responding to other answers. Now that we have some background,let'stalk aboutarecent support issue I ran into. In this case, it turns out one of our Microsoft Developers, Matt Olson, thought of this already. This PowerShell wrapper extends the functionality of, and provides automated management and updates for, etl2pcapng.exe. Installing another tool on your systemsto capture network tracesisnt always going to be an acceptable optionin many companies either. How can I explain to my manager that a project he wishes to undertake cannot be performed by the team? Making statements based on opinion; back them up with references or personal experience. No improvements toNetmonhave been madesince2010 butis still available for download from Microsoft. Typically a project like this is broken into two parts: write the PowerShell code to read the CSV . ETL2PCAPNG takesanETLfilethat was generated using NETSHandconverts the network frames to a new version of the CAP format, called PCAPNG. Setting up a PowerShell script to import the tables is a fairly simple process. Maybe youwant to review that data yourself. This allows you to generate the ETL file on the server, copy to your local machine, or approved jump box/tools machine/etc and convert the ETL file there. What is an ETL Trace File? A quick and easy PowerShell script to collect a packet trace, with an option to convert .etl to .pcap. Pktmon pcapng syntax sign in Press Ctrl+C to stop monitoring. How can I replace every occurrence of a String in a file with PowerShell? Install-Module -Name Convert-Etl2Pcapng -RequiredVersion 2020.4.20. Unfortunately, other than showing that traffic is occurring, this information does not provide detailed information as to what is in the packet. Well, as I mentioned above, Microsoft has the Microsoft Message Analyzer which can open these files and even convert them to a format other networking tools can read. For more information see the Code of Conduct FAQ or How can we convert these ETL files that the, Welcome to the world of Open Source software. After running you should have all your events in $TraceLog.Events, including payload. If you type pktmon start help, you will now see a new -l flag that allows you to specify the log mode used by the sniffer. Surely, our customers will want to be able to generate and analyze their own network traces without needing to rely on Microsoft Support. In PowerShell, how do I define a function in a file and call it from the PowerShell commandline? Staging Ground Beta 1 Recap, and Reviewers needed for Beta 2. 1.7.0 - Include VMSwitch packet info in packet comments. This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ository. A tag already exists with the provided branch name. Utility that converts an .etl file containing a Windows network packet capture into .pcapng format. However, it can be tedious, especially if the files have different formats. You can read all about what NETSH can be used for, . Simply opening the CABfileyou can see there are lots of TXT files with human readableSystemInformation,RegistryKeys, and EventLogs. Viewed 2k times . More information on these commands can be found in our more detailed pktmon article. It also captures some related diagnostic information and compresses that information into a CAB file. It is possible that a new version of PowerShellGet will be needed before the module will install from PSGallery. . Update-Etl2Pcapng. replacement in development as of the time of this posting. Surely, our customers will want to be able to generate and analyze their own network traces without needing to rely on Microsoft Support. Lucky for us there's an easy conversion utility etl2pcapng. The nature of simulating nature: A Q&A with IBM Quantum researcher Dr. Jamie We've added a "Necessary cookies only" option to the cookie consent popup. I advised my customer to download this tool anduse it toreview the network traces while Support is doing the same. For more information see the Code of Conduct FAQ or BakerStreetForensics 2022 Year inReview, Group collections from O365 withPowerShell, Mal-Hash interacting with Virus Total API viaPowerShell, Note there are 3 lines (the first may wrap depending on windows size). Even worse, Microsoft has pulled Microsoft Message Analyzer from all official download locations effective November 25th, 2019.

Judge Robinson Butler, Pa, Iphone Panic Log Analyzer, Crease Of Nose Smells Like Cheese, Articles C